Summary:Featuring a compilation of chapters related to kidney function that appear in Harrison's Principles of Internal Medicine, Eighteenth Edition, this concise, full-color clinical companion delivers the latest knowledge in the field backed by the scientific rigor and authority that have defined Harrison's. You will find content from renowned editors and contributors in a carry-anywhere presentation that is ideal for the classroom, clinic, ward, or exam/certification preparation. Complete coverage of a broad spectrum of topics, including acid-base and electrolyte disorders, vascular injury to the kidney, and specific diseases of the kidney. Integration of pathophysiology with clinical management. 41 high-yield questions and answers drawn from Harrison's Principles of Internal Medicine Self-Assessment and Board Review, 18 edition. Content updates and new developments since the publication of Harrison's Principles of Internal Medicine, 18 edition, with 22 chapters written by physicians who are recognized experts in the field of nephrology and acid-base disorders. Helpful appendix of laboratory values of clinical importance.
